BEIJING, Aug. 7 (Xinhua) -- The middle route of China's South-to-North Water Diversion Project has delivered more than 80 billion cubic meters of water as of Friday, benefiting nearly 118 million residents in 27 cities, the project operator announced.

The mega water transfer project, the largest of its kind globally, channels water over long distances from the country's water-rich south to its northern regions, where hundreds of millions once endured "absolute water scarcity" as defined by United Nations standards.

After operating for nearly 12 years, the middle route has helped rebalance water resources, secure drinking water supplies, restore aquatic ecosystems, and reinforce national water security, according to the China South-to-North Water Diversion Corporation.

The impact has been particularly pronounced in Beijing, where diverted water now accounts for nearly 80 percent of the capital's urban water supply. In neighboring Hebei Province, the combined population of the water recipient areas accounts for about 70 percent of the province's total.

The project's middle route has consistently maintained surface water quality at Class II or above, reversed the long-term decline of groundwater levels, and continued to improve river and lake ecosystems in north China, the operator said.

It has also provided critical water support for drought relief, irrigation and food security, while creating broader space for urban development and industrial layout optimization.

Designed with three routes, the South-to-North Water Diversion Project stretches across four of China's major river basins: the Yangtze, Huaihe, Yellow and Haihe.

The eastern route leverages ancient canals, starting from the city of Yangzhou in east China's Jiangsu Province, and uses 13 pumping stations to lift water.

On the other hand, the middle route relies on gravity to transport water from the Danjiangkou Reservoir, primarily located in central China's Hubei Province, to regions such as Henan, Hebei, Beijing and Tianjin.
